The 2004 Midwest crop yields were record-breaking due to unique weather conditions, including an unusually high number of sunny days that aided photosynthesis. This anomaly in atmospheric circulation patterns contributed to the exceptional yields, which surpassed predictions and models.
A new computer model predicts that soybean rust, a highly aggressive form of the disease, has already spread to Brazil and Venezuela, putting the US at high risk. The model suggests that the disease will reach the US within the current growing season or no later than two years.
A team led by Evan DeLucia will use genomic technologies to understand how soybeans respond to climate change, including greenhouse gases and drought conditions. The research aims to identify key genes driving these responses and improve crop productivity.

A team of researchers has successfully synthesized polyols from soy oil through air oxidation, offering a sustainable alternative to traditional petroleum-based chemicals. This breakthrough could lead to the development of biocompatible and biodegradable materials for various industries.
Kansas State University researchers are using geographic tools to track the spread of a highly invasive soybean aphid, which could have significant implications for national security. By analyzing data and mapping patterns, they aim to predict future outbreaks and develop an early warning system.
A study published in Agronomy Journal suggests that producers can reduce seeding rates for Roundup Ready soybeans without affecting yield, especially in northern Wisconsin. This approach could be economically viable for farmers in certain regions, but current recommendations may still be suitable.
Research found that inter-seeding winter cereal rye with organic soybeans reduces weed growth and increases yield, but requires specific termination methods for effective management. The study suggests a new approach to organic weed control that prioritizes soil health and sustainability.

The US soybean industry is shifting away from mature markets like the US, with companies investing in new growth areas like Brazil and Argentina. This change is driven by weak intellectual property rights and access to Roundup Ready technology, which has accelerated soybean production expansion.
A team of scientists will sequence a large DNA segment in soybeans and its wild relatives to identify genes for disease resistance. This step is crucial for isolating and transferring these genes to crops with enhanced disease resistance, an alternative to pesticide use.
A recent study suggests that rising ozone levels could lead to a significant loss of $21 million annually in US soybean production over the next 30 years. Researchers found that soybeans suffer from reduced photosynthesis and biomass, resulting in fewer seeds and pods, and decreased seed weight.
This study found that elevated tropospheric ozone concentrations inhibit photosynthesis in soybeans, leading to decreased growth and yield. The results suggest a potential annual loss of $21 million for the US soybean industry based on current production levels.

Researchers have successfully expressed a variant of the maize anthranilate synthase (AS) gene in soybean seeds to increase tryptophan content. The modifications aim to improve the nutritional value of soybeans, but further testing is needed to confirm results.
Scientists investigated how day length affects soybean flowering, finding early flowering is more active and controlled by small developing leaves or buds. The study's results could help develop cultivars adapted to short growing seasons for northern Canadian soybean producers.
Plant pathologists and experts will discuss Soybean Rust's potential impact on US agriculture, citing significant yield losses and costly fungicide control measures. The symposium will focus on disease management tools, resistant breeding programs, detection methods, and a new USDA Action Plan.
A study found that organic production practices had a slight impact on corn and soybean yields, with reductions of up to 19% compared to conventional methods. The organic strategy also had lower production costs, but net returns were equivalent to the conventional strategy.

Researchers have developed a new vegetable oil that can provide performance-enhancing benefits to car engines, improving stability at both hot and cold temperatures. The biodegradable oil could reduce the country's dependence on foreign oil and minimize environmental harm.
A recent study found that gradual temperature increases cause significant decreases in crop productivity for corn and soybeans. Climate is identified as a crucial factor in crop yield trends, contradicting previous assumptions. The study's unique approach separates the effects of climate and technology on yield trends.
NASA's space station has successfully grown its first commercial farming experiment - soybeans grown in microgravity. The experiment, conducted by DuPont, aims to accelerate crop development and improve crop yields.

Scientists are sequencing the genomes of two deadly Phytophthora microbe species to understand their genetic secrets. The goal is to develop effective treatments and diagnostic tools for sudden oak death syndrome and soybean root rot, causing billions of dollars in damage annually.
A randomized trial found that lean ground beef fortified with soybean phytosterols lowered plasma total cholesterol by 9.3%, LDL cholesterol by 14.6%, and the ratio of total to high-density lipoprotein (HDL) cholesterol by 9.1% in 4 weeks. This study suggests a lower-fat alternative for lowering CVD risk.
Researchers found that diets rich in soy protein and flaxseed can decrease total cholesterol, triglycerides, and glucose levels in obese rats. Flaxseed also showed a greater effect on various parameters than soybean, suggesting potential benefits for humans.
Researchers at Purdue University recommend consuming omega-3 rich foods like fish, lean meat, fruits, and vegetables to balance fatty acids. Limiting omega-6 fat sources, such as processed meats and vegetable oils, can also help reduce chronic diseases.

Researchers found that store-bought tofu, soy cheese, and soy drinks contain significant levels of oxalate, which can bind with calcium in the kidneys to form kidney stones. The American Dietetic Association recommends limiting oxalate intake to 10 milligrams per serving for patients with a history of kidney stones.
The SoyFACE experiment is the first test of crop growth in the presence of both increased carbon dioxide and ozone. This summer, researchers will evaluate how soybeans respond to higher CO2 levels and ozone exposure on 40 acres with 24 experimental rings.
Scientists say Western corn rootworms are changing behavior, laying eggs in soybean fields instead of corn, due to crop rotation failure. The beetles' adaptation poses a significant threat to corn crops in the Midwest, potentially costing $100 million per year to control.
University of Delaware scientists have developed a technique to produce inexpensive, lightweight composites using soybean oil. The new material has been tested on a door-sized prototype weighing just 25 pounds and demonstrates comparable strength and stiffness to commercial vinyl-ester based composites.
